Overview of the Acquisition
Qualcomm has announced its acquisition of MovianAI, the former generative AI division of VinAI. This strategic move aims to enhance Qualcomm’s capabilities in artificial intelligence, particularly in generative AI, machine learning, and computer vision. By integrating MovianAI’s advanced research with Qualcomm’s extensive experience, the company plans to drive significant innovations in AI technology. Qualcomm has a long history of collaboration with Vietnam’s tech ecosystem, contributing to the growth of the local information and communication technology sector.
Key Details
- Qualcomm aims to leverage VinAI’s expertise to enhance its AI solutions.
- The acquired team is led by Dr. Hung Bui, a former Google DeepMind expert.
- This acquisition will focus on developing cutting-edge technologies for various industries, including smartphones and automotive.
- Qualcomm has been actively involved in Vietnam’s tech landscape for over 20 years, fostering innovation and global market entry for Vietnamese companies.
